Handover — Ledgerquill PDF Invoice Renderer

Welcome aboard. The renderer runs on the Brantside cluster and regenerates invoices nightly. Watch the font-embedding step: if the Tindervale glyph cache is stale, totals render as boxes, so purge it first when debugging. Templates are versioned; never edit the live set directly. Signing certificates sit in an encrypted bundle in the ops share. To unlock that bundle for your first deployment, use the recovery passphrase below.

strongbox words: praath-pelys-ulaion

Heads up, plugin folks: if your Snapdeck account gets locked after too many failed snapshot-baseline uploads, don't open a new account — your component snapshots are tied to the old one. Use the self-service recovery flow instead; it restores your baseline history too. When the flow asks for verification, enter the recovery passphrase that appears below.

unlock words, hadug-hahif: istius-soriel-belion-framir-holath-raldor-lamdor

## Runbook: Nightly Catalogue Import — Lumenstack Library

The import job pulls MARC records from the internal ShelfSync service every night at 02:00. If the job fails, check the staging table first; partial imports must be rolled back before retrying. Never rerun the job while a rollback is in progress. The job authenticates to ShelfSync with a service key, rotated each quarter. The current key is below.

service key, bafop-kafop: qvz2-us

Welcome to the Wrenfold address autocomplete widget. Reviewers should confirm that every suggestion request goes through our proxy, never directly from the browser, and that debounce stays at 250ms. Local testing requires credentials for the internal Gazetteer lookup service. For your sandbox environment, use the following key.

app token of bahaf-tajeg = zpat23_SjjsllwiLmXbtS65veZaV47